Just finished reading this authors' latest novel, "The Gospel of Lucifer". In it he brings up a lot of the theories and subjects that has been discussed here, but i a dramatized format and without references to other densities.

Spoiler alert:
He talks about the nephilim as being the origin of the Lucifer myth, and writes about how subjects in the bible stems from earlier sumerian and babylonian writings. He mentions Sitchin and lots of others, even writes about the possibility of a cometary impact in the near future. He made a webpage with literature references here: _http://www.tomegeland.com/en/books/lucifers+evangelium/

The book itself is a decent novel, not on par with the best page turners but a worthy read because of the subject material, in my opinion.
